Tankers, particularly VLCC, are experiencing a significant rise in the market, according to recent data from the Baltic Exchange. The TC1 75kt MEG/Japan index surged 209 points to WS785, generating approximately $232,000 per day on a Baltic round trip basis. Meanwhile, the TC20 90kt MEG/UK-Continent index saw a substantial increase of 66% to $16.5 million.
In Europe, the TC15 80kt Mediterranean/East index decreased modestly to $6.1 million, with the TCE now at just under $38,000 per day. The LR1 MEG rates also saw a dramatic climb, with the TC5 55kt MEG/Japan index increasing 191 points to WS820. The TD3C route, transporting 270,000 mt Middle East Gulf oil to China, rose 21% from WS677.78 to WS821.11, resulting in a daily round-trip TCE of $862,150.
Similarly, the TD34 route from the Gulf of Oman to China increased 62%, reaching a daily TCE of $465,764. In the US Gulf market, the TC14 38kt index declined from WS250 to WS220, while the TC21 38kt US Gulf/Caribbean route decreased by $115,000, with a Baltic TCE of $14,700. Meanwhile, the TC17 35kt MEG/East Africa route increased from WS556 to WS708, providing a daily TCE of $86,600.
Across the Atlantic, the rate for the 70,000 mt US Gulf/UK Continent route climbed 136 points to WS375, with a daily round-trip TCE of nearly $99,400.
